Project Overview

At the entrance of AEON CINEMA, AOTO’s CV1.8 LED display has become a standout feature. Its ultra-high resolution and fine pixel pitch deliver vibrant and lifelike visuals. The display showcases movie trailers and promotional content, giving customers a clear look at the latest film offerings. Thanks to its high brightness and wide viewing angle, the screen ensures visibility day or night. Its modular design makes installation and maintenance easy, offering an efficient solution for the cinema’s daily operations.
